interface Visitor<T> {
    _: (name: string, value: any) => T;
    installClang: (value: AutoTestInstallClangStepOutput) => T;
    installDotnet: (value: AutoTestInstallDotnetStepOutput) => T;
    installGcc: (value: AutoTestInstallGccStepOutput) => T;
    installJava: (value: AutoTestInstallJavaStepOutput) => T;
    installNode: (value: AutoTestInstallNodeStepOutput) => T;
    installPython: (value: AutoTestInstallPythonStepOutput) => T;
    script: (value: AutoTestScriptStepOutput) => T;
    uploadFiles: (value: AutoTestUploadFilesStepOutput) => T;
}

Type Parameters

  • T

Properties

_: (name: string, value: any) => T
installClang: (value: AutoTestInstallClangStepOutput) => T
installDotnet: (value: AutoTestInstallDotnetStepOutput) => T
installGcc: (value: AutoTestInstallGccStepOutput) => T
installJava: (value: AutoTestInstallJavaStepOutput) => T
installNode: (value: AutoTestInstallNodeStepOutput) => T
installPython: (value: AutoTestInstallPythonStepOutput) => T
script: (value: AutoTestScriptStepOutput) => T
uploadFiles: (value: AutoTestUploadFilesStepOutput) => T